Podcast Overview

Interviews with mathematics education researchers about recent studies. Hosted by Samuel Otten, University of Missouri.<br><br>www.mathedpodcast.com<br>Produced by Fibre Studios

Episode 2603: Juli Dixon - career in math education

Juli Dixon from the University of Central Florida discusses her career in mathematics education, going back to her intentions as a 7th grader, her work across the grade levels and adult education, problem solving, geometric transformations, multilingual learners, and sociomathematical norms.Juli's website: https://www.dnamath.com/&nbsp;Juli's book series: Solution Tree "Making Sense of Mathematics for Teaching"List of episodes&nbsp;

Episode 2602: Susan Empson - career in math education

Episode 2602: Susan Empson discusses her career in mathematics education research, from the University of Wisconsin through the CGI project and students' fraction strategies to several additional studies at the University of Texas and the University of Missouri.Susan's Professional Webpage:&nbsp;https://cehd.missouri.edu/person/susan-empson/Susan's ResearchGate Profile (can request articles):&nbsp;https://www.researchgate.net/profile/Susan-EmpsonSusan's Fraction Book for Teachers:&nbsp;Extending Children's Mathematics: Fractions &amp; DecimalsList of episodes
